Galam Rocked. I still have my Turbo Dou. Main question here. I
have played Y's 1-3, but have never seen 4. I know it was an import,
but could never find it for sale. Also, since Cosmic Fantasy was
2, were there ever prequels or sequels? Just wondering.
-Vatali
|
|
JD:
Cosmic Fantasy was the first big Working Designs RPG, and it was
glorious. I don't buy the doom and gloomers putting this game down,
it was absolutely brilliant. It was one of the first stories that
encompassed the plot line of love and death, it was powerful, and
lets not forget the Working Designs comedy, which in my opinion
was the most tasteful use of it in a Working Designs game. Now about
your question...Yes there was a Cosmic Fantasy 1 which to my understanding
was a decent game. There also was a Cosmic Fantasy 3, 4 Part 1 and
2. These were released only in japan however, but have been occasionally
spotted at Ebay.com.

Before I ask this question, great picture of the week for 8-31,
made me crack up. Since you seem to know a bit about vg soundtracks
(amen!) and since they are so damn costly (but hey, it's worth $45
(with shipping) for Final Fantasy: 1987-1994! (ack that's almost
more than the entire cost of ff8... anways)),
which do you recommend out of the Dragon Quest Symphonies (out
of 1-4)? My first incliation is to the dragon quest symphony best,
but dragon quest 3 symphonic suite looks awesome too. DQ1 and DQ2
Symphony suite doesn't sound that compelling since half the cd is
the original nintendo sound, but I haven't heard them so I have
no idea. Also, what do you think of the FF7 Reunion tracks and the
FFT/Xenogears, and before I get the seiken densetsu ones? *inserts
another complaint about too many potentially good sounding tracks
and too much cost!* thanks,
-starrealms
|
|
JD:
You really can't go wrong with any choice. With FF 87-94 you'll
get a more varied arrangement than the DQ Symphonies, though good
get a tad repetitive. My favorite is probably the DQ 3 SS album,
but as you know the Enix albums are quite rigid and conservative
classically speaking. I prefer the falcom symphonies which do sound
better and more complex.
As far as FF7 Reunion the new 3 arranged tracks are very well done,
though I wouldn't buy it. My suggestion for a Square album purchase
would be either FF8 OSV or Xenogears OSV. Happy listening....
